The Reality Behind the Price Drop

Conventional marine distillates have faced relentless price turbulence, driven by volatile crude markets and geopolitical disruptions in key supply corridors. Meanwhile, biodiesel pricing operates on a different rhythm. It responds heavily to agricultural feedstock availability rather than pure petro-politics.

When you look at the raw price tag per metric tonne at the bunker port, fossil fuels might still look slightly cheaper on paper. But paper prices lie.

The moment you stack up regional carbon compliance frameworks—such as FuelEU Maritime or emissions trading schemes—the financial equation changes completely. Compliance costs money. Carbon permits cost money. When you factor in the penalty costs of burning high-emission heavy fuel oil, biodiesel emerges as the clear winner on total voyage expenses.

Why Compliance Changes Everything

Regulations are no longer a distant threat on a PowerPoint slide. They are hitting balance sheets right now.

Shipowners operating in European waters face strict carbon-intensity reduction targets. If you stick strictly to conventional marine gas oil, you bleed cash buying allowances or paying statutory penalties.

Drop-in biofuels like B100 FAME (fatty acid methyl ester) or blended options like B30 change that math instantly. They slash your net CO2 exposure on paper and in practice. Because the emissions penalty is avoided, the total cost of operation drops below that of burning untaxed or lightly taxed fossil fuels.

Fleet managers are noticing. Operators who previously kept biodiesel strictly as an emergency compliance tool are now writing long-term offtake agreements.

The Operational Catch Nobody Talks About

Before you rush out to load your tanks with 100 percent biodiesel, pump the brakes. It is not a magical plug-and-play liquid without quirks.

Biodiesel behaves differently than standard marine gas oil. It has lower energy density. That means you burn through slightly more volume to cover the exact same nautical miles.

It also has a nasty habit of attracting moisture and oxidizing over time if left sitting in storage tanks. If your crew doesn't manage fuel turnover and tank cleanliness aggressively, you will run into blocked filters and fuel starvation issues mid-voyage.

Smart operators avoid these traps by sticking to blends like B30 for their initial trials. A 30 percent biofuel and 70 percent conventional blend gives you most of the carbon-credit benefits while keeping operational risks low. You don't need engine retrofits or complex mechanical overhauls. You just pump it in and go.

Supply Realities and the Road Sector Competition

There is a bottleneck you should prepare for. Shipping is not the only industry trying to buy green diesel.

The road transport sector has chased biodiesel and hydrotreated vegetable oil (HVO) for years, backed by heavy subsidies and established distribution networks. Marine buyers often find themselves competing with trucking fleets for the same barrels of waste-based feedstock.

If global demand spikes faster than refinery capacity, regional supply pinches will happen. Port availability varies wildly. You might find cheap, compliant biofuel readily available in Rotterdam, but struggle to source certified sustainable batches in smaller regional hubs.
